Hi Matthew, how do you think about risk?
I began my career on the public equities trading desk at Goldman Sachs—public investing is all about pricing risk: risk to the upside, risk to the downside. And when risk is mispriced, there’s an opportunity to generate profits. Shortly after I started, the dot-com bubble was booming—and then it crashed. I watched fortunes vanish overnight. I also saw fortunes made by those who managed risk well.

Later, at my own investment firm, the lessons I learned during the dot-com crash helped guide me through the 2007–2008 financial crisis. I was able to manage risk and actually made money for my clients during that time. COVID was no different. And now, the trade wars and tariff-related sell-offs are no different either.

Taking risks—and managing them—is core to how we think, how we invest, and where we find our edge.
